About The Position

Evaluates and treats patients with injuries or diseases resulting in loss of physical or functional abilities; supervises work performed by support personnel; effectively communicates and collaborates with patients, families and members of the healthcare team. Performs initial and on-going assessments of patient's condition and establishes goals and plan of care which is appropriate to problems identified and involves the patient/family according to their capabilities and desires. Performs therapy interventions utilizing standard, and, possibly specialized, physical therapy techniques and skills as appropriate for the age and condition of the patient. Completes documentation to comply with department, hospital and regulatory standards. Participates in departmental initiatives for operational improvement, including committees and educational offerings. Performs other duties as assigned or required. Requirements

  • Minimum Bachelor’s Degree
  • State licensure as a Physical Therapist or eligible.
  • CPR – American Heart Association
  • Act 34 Criminal Background Clearance Certificate
  • Act 33 Child Abuse Clearance Certificate
  • Act 73 FBI Fingerprinting Criminal Background Clearance Certificate

Nice To Haves

  • Master’s Degree.
  • Current state driver’s license.
